The Golden State Pops Orchestra (GSPO) was formed in January of 2002 and is currently the only year-round pops orchestra in the Los Angeles area. The GSPO focuses on exciting and innovative concerts that are designed to entertain both the seasoned enthusiast as well as the casual music lover. 2012/13 Tickets go on sale September 1, 2012 with Assigned Seating.

For over three decades, Varèse Sarabande Records has been home to more of film music's greatest composers than any other label. Founded in the spring of 1978, Varèse Sarabande became the first label solely dedicated to film music – releasing dozens of new film scores each year, along with countless classics from Hollywood's glorious Golden Age. Many of the label's first recordings were produced by the great George Korngold and conducted by the legendary likes of Miklós Rózsa and Elmer Bernstein.
Over the years, the Varèse film music family grew to include virtually everyone you could think of, but with over 80 releases, no composer's music appeared more frequently on the label than Jerry Goldsmith's. Now with a catalog of over 1500 soundtrack albums, which grows by 60 to 70 titles each year, Varèse Sarabande remains the most prolific film music label in the world.
On May 11, 2013 the Golden State Pops Orchestra will stage a historic concert in celebration of Varèse Sarabande's 35th Anniversary and host a gathering of the label's roster of composers, along with other dignitaries from the film music world of Los Angeles.
A special concert program has been prepared specifically for the GSPO by Robert Townson, producer of over 1200 of Varese Sarabande's soundtrack releases since 1986. Townson will host the evening and present highlights from the label's past, with music by Jerry Goldsmith (Rudy), Alex North (Spartacus) and Georges Delerue (World Concert Premiere of Academy Award-winning A Little Romance, featuring flute soloist Sara Andon), plus a wide selection of contemporary blockbusters by Hans Zimmer, Michael Giacchino, John Powell, Danny Elfman and many others.

Travel to a galaxy far, far away with Luke Skywalker, Princess Leia, Yoda and Han Solo as the GSPO performs our favorite selections by legendary composer John Williams' iconic Star Wars scores, including Star Wars: Main Title, Imperial March, Princess Leia's Theme, and the Star Wars: Attack of the Clones tragic love theme, Across The Stars.
In 2005 GSPO performed the North American concert premiere of John Williams' Battle of the Heroes from Star Wars: Revenge of the Sith. The family friendly orchestra continues to introduce audiences to new repertoire by presenting music inspired by the Star Wars Universe - books, video games, fan films and spin-off films such as Star Wars: The Clone Wars. Experience music from the videogames Star Wars: The Old Republic and Star Wars Kinect and fan film Ryan vs. Dorkman by Kyle Newmaster and Gordy Haab. The 2013 celebration of the 35th Anniversary of the Varese Sarabande record label continues with the musical score composed by Joel McNeely and released on Varese Sarabande for the 1996 novel Star Wars: Shadows of the Empire, written by Steve Perry.
